This is my first ever embellished piece I created.
For my year 11 Home Economics subject we had to sew a corset that was fully lined with boning and an invisible zip.
This was a challenge for me being not the best sewer at the time, but the idea of embellishing the corset was the most exciting part and I rushed through the construction of the corset.

I remember all the girls in my class creating cute pink and blue corsets out of cotton but I wanted a fancy corset and made mine out of gold satin. I spent hours at home the next few weeks sewing around the shapes of flowers, painting them with gold and fraying them individually with my quick unpick which took a lot longer than I thought.

I purchased pearl beads and rhinestones and stared putting everything together. I loved every moment of it. I think I spent triple the time everyone else did on their corset but for me it such a passion that I couldn’t stop working on it.

At the end of the year school fashion show together with my Home Economics teacher we made a full floor length skirt out of curtain fabric and paired it with my corset to look like a wedding dress.
I got to be the end act of the show and I remember after wards being asked by many girls in my grade to design their formal dresses for them.
